09:19:32 <jmd> Whenever I try to run gnucash it crashes with the following error:
09:19:52 <jmd> Backtrace:
09:19:52 <jmd> In unknown file:
09:19:52 <jmd> ?: 0* [primitive-load-path "slib/guile.init"]
09:19:52 <jmd> <unnamed port>: In procedure primitive-load-path in expression (primitive-load-path name):
09:19:52 <jmd> <unnamed port>: Unable to find file "slib/guile.init" in load path
09:20:28 <jmd> Version 2.3.17
10:05:38 *** bentob0x has joined #gnucash
10:17:05 *** warlord-afk is now known as warlord
10:17:18 <warlord> jmd: What OS/Distro? Looks like slib isn't installed/configured properly.
10:17:39 <jmd> warlord, GNU/Linux debian lenny
10:17:41 <warlord> And yes, with 2.3/2.4 you can use MySQL/Postgres for your data to be remote, but you're still limited to single-use
10:17:56 <warlord> jmd: Do you have multiple versions of guile installed?
10:18:05 <jmd> No.
10:18:08 <warlord> And did you build gnucash yourself or use the prebuilt version?
10:18:17 <jmd> Built it myself.
10:18:31 <warlord> And how did you install the dependencies?
10:18:34 <warlord> By hand?
10:18:39 <jmd> apt-get
10:19:20 <warlord> Huh! apt-get build-dep gnucash should install the proper deps.. And configure should test for a working guile/slib...
10:19:32 <warlord> Can you verify that you've only got one version of guile installed?
10:19:45 <warlord> Please pastebin the output of the apt command to list all 'guile' packages
10:19:59 <jmd> But I'm on stable and I want to build the latest gnucash
10:21:24 <warlord> That's fine. Please pastebin the output of the apt command to list all the 'guile' packages installed.
10:23:45 <jmd> http://pastebin.com/Lj1KCyjW
10:24:03 <jmd> There's a library from 1.6 - perhaps that's the problem.
10:24:17 <warlord> Yep, probably.
10:24:22 <warlord> That's what I wanted to check.
10:24:31 <warlord> Most likely it's using a combination of 1.6 and 1.8.
10:24:56 <jmd> removing it now.
10:26:01 <jmd> And apt-get build-dep gnucash says "E: Build-dependencies for gnucash could not be satisfied."
10:27:26 <jmd> Running make install again...
10:28:35 <warlord> You'll need to do more than make install..
10:28:41 <warlord> You'll need to restart from configure.
10:28:58 <jmd> Ahhhh!!!
10:33:13 <jmd> Hmm. Now I get Cannot find SLIB. Are you sure you have it installed?
10:33:17 <warlord> Your dependencies changed, you need to make sure gnucash finds the right one.
10:33:19 <jmd> I didn't get that before.
10:33:29 <warlord> You'll need to add a symlink so that guile 1.8 can find it.
10:33:36 <warlord> Right, because gnucash was still using 1.6

11:13:42 <kleinerdrache> i just found a posting from 2005 where it says to save as "postgres://localhost/mydbname" would save my actual file to the database
11:14:02 <kleinerdrache> but here in gnucash 2.2.9 this seems not to work
11:14:05 <kleinerdrache> is there any other way?
11:14:21 <warlord> kleinerdrache: a) that required building gnucash with PG support, and b) that support was removed in 2.2 because it was out-dated, broken, and incomplete.
11:14:56 <warlord> In 2.4 we're re-adding SQL support, and you'll be able to Save-As and choose SQLite, MySQL, or PG as your backends, if your system is configured to support them.
11:15:13 <warlord> SQL will not be the default file format for 2.4.
11:15:20 <warlord> (we're still working the bugs out of the system)
11:15:50 <kleinerdrache> warlord, so i could use a newer version? but this would be unstable, right?
11:16:04 <kleinerdrache> for 2.3.17 the announcement says it would work
11:16:42 <warlord> right, but 2.3.17 is still only a 2.4 release candidate, and there are known issues.
11:17:17 <warlord> I personally wouldn't use the SQL backend for my real data yet.. not without keeping a duplicate copy in XML and making sure I make entries in both places.
11:20:47 <jmd> When I tell it to create a new account. It asks me what currency and defaults to USD. It should get that default from my locale?
11:23:41 <warlord> I believe it should. What's your locale?
11:23:56 <jmd> de_DE.UTF-8
11:24:01 <kleinerdrache> warlord, ok, but in 2.4 you would do use the sql interface? when will it come?
11:25:03 <warlord> kleinerdrache: it'll come in 2.4, but I'd still be wary. The XML backend has had over a decade of real-world usage to work out all the issues. The SQL code is new; nobody has used it in production yet.
11:25:23 <warlord> So no, even through 2.4 I'd still keep duplicate books. By 2.6 I think all the bugs will be worked out.

13:46:24 <rhn> I'm trying to print an invoice with gnucash, but I can't find a way to enter my company name and address. can anyone help?
13:47:38 <warlord> rhn: File -> Properties
13:52:12 <rhn> thanks, warlord! it shows up as intended now. it's a wonder that I couldn't find any info on the net either
